minifb is a cross platform library written in Rust that makes to open windows (usually native to the running operating system) and can optionally show a 32-bit buffer. minifb also support keyboard, mouse input and menus on selected operating systems.
Structs
Menu | Menu holds info for menus |
MenuItem | Holds info about each item in a menu |
UnixMenu | Used on Unix (Linux, FreeBSD, etc) as menus aren't supported in a native where there. This structure can be used by calling [#get_unix_menus] on Window. |
UnixMenuItem | Used for on Unix (Linux, FreeBSD, etc) as menus aren't supported in a native where there. This structure holds info for each item in a #UnixMenu |
Window | Window is used to open up a window. It's possible to optionally display a 32-bit buffer when the widow is set as non-resizable. |
WindowOptions | WindowOptions is creation settings for the window. By default the settings are defined for displayng a 32-bit buffer (no scaling of window is possible) |
Enums
CursorStyle | Different style of cursors that can be used |
Error | Errors that can be return from various operatiors |
Key | Key is used by the get key functions to check if some keys on the keyboard has been pressed |
KeyRepeat | Used for is_key_pressed and get_keys_pressed() to indicated if repeat of presses is wanted |
MouseButton | The various mouse buttons that are availible |
MouseMode | The diffrent modes that can be used to decide how mouse coordinates should be handled |
Scale | Scale will scale the frame buffer and the window that is being sent in when calling the update function. This is useful if you for example want to display a 320 x 256 window on a screen with much higher resolution which would result in that the window is very small. |
